Vitamins for Liver: Learn Which Vitamins are Good for Liver Health (2024)

Vitamins are necessary to help the liver perform its tasks, i.e., digestion, synthesising proteins, producing hormones, and filtering toxins present in diet and environment. Therefore, inadequate intake of essential vitamins can affect liver health and disrupt its functions.

Which Vitamins Are Good for the Liver?

Vitamins that play a crucial role in maintaining liver health include vitamin D, E, C, B. Individuals need to take these vitamins regularly through a healthy diet plan.

Vitamin C

Vitamin C is an antioxidant –a key element that helps to neutralise molecules known as free radicals. A low level of antioxidants can create a disparity called oxidative stress. As a result, this imbalance can cast a negative effect on cells and cause liver diseases.

Nonetheless, vitamin C also helps to limit fat accumulation in the liver and prevent fatty liver disease.

Vitamin D

Vitamin D is one of the essentialvitamins for the liver,which helps to prevent metabolic liver disease and inflammatory disease.

As per astudy conducted in 2009, 92% of the total 118 people who are suffering from chronic liver disease have vitamin D deficiency. Similarly, another 2013 study tried to associate vitamin D deficiency with Hepatitis B (HBV), a virus that can adversely affect liver health.

Vitamin E

Like vitamin C, vitamin E is an antioxidant that helps maintain the level of other antioxidants and free radicals. However, individuals who have Non-alcoholic Fatty Liver Disease (NAFLD) and Non-alcoholic steatohepatitis suffer from inadequate vitamin E, primarily from oxidative stress. Oxidative stress can affect cells and arise from drugs, alcohol and other factors.

According to a2014 study, individuals who took vitamin E for more than 96 weeks have reduced inflammation and fat level in the liver. The study further shows that the intake of vitamin D for that longer period also helped lower liver cell death.

Essential Vitamins for Liver Health

Benefits and Importance

Source of Vitamins

Vitamin B

Vitamin B helps to create reverse symptoms of liver diseases, which are in their early stages.

Eggs, Milk, Cheese, Fish (tuna, salmon), Meat (chicken, red meat), Vegetables, dark green vegetables, Beans (kidney beans, black beans), Shellfish (oysters and clams), Fruits (banana, watermelon), Soy products (soy milk, tempeh), Whole grains and cereals, Wheat germ, Blackstrap molasses, Yeast and nutritional yeast

Vitamin C

Vitamin C helps to neutralise free radicals and prevent liver disease and fatty liver disease.

Citrus fruit, such as oranges and orange juice, Blackcurrants, Broccoli, Peppers, Strawberries, Brussels sprouts, Potatoes

Vitamin D

Vitamin D helps to prevent inflammatory and metabolic liver disease.

Oily fish (such as herring salmon, sardines, and mackerel), Egg yolks, Red meat, Liver, Fortified foods( such as breakfast cereals and some fat spreads)

Vitamin E

Vitamin E helps to balance antioxidants and free radicals. Further, it helps prevent liver cell death.

Plant oils including rapeseed (vegetable oil), sunflower, soya, corn and olive oil, Wheat germ (it can be found in cereals and cereal products), Nuts and seeds

What Are the Vitamin Deficiency Diseases Linked to Poor Liver Health?

  • Around 90% of vitamin B12is stored in the liver. When the liver health deteriorates, the stored Vitamin B12 level also decreases, leading to deficiency diseases.Inadequate vitamin B12 in the body can lead to anaemia. In this medical condition, an individual’s red blood cell count reaches below the standard level.
  • Low serum vitamin D can cause non-alcoholic fatty liver disease.
  • Also, vitamin D looks after the bone structure and condition. The deficiency of vitamin D can affect calcium absorption and lead to weaker bones. Additionally, chronic liver disease may develop another medical condition called osteoporosis, where bones weaken, making patients prone to bone fracture. Vitamin D inadequacy can degrade this situation even further.
  • Insufficient vitamin E has been noticed mostly in patients with primary biliary Cirrhosis and other chronic cholestatic diseases.
  • It has been noticed that liver diseases can cause B1, B6 and B12 deficiencies.
  • Consequently, insufficient vitamin B1 can affect mental health and hamper certain functions such as memory and coordination.
  • A low level of B6 can result in symptoms of tingling and numbness, which can arise from nerve damage.

Effects of Long-term Vitamin Deficiency on Liver

As per astudy, patients with Cirrhosis have vitamin D deficiency. The study shows, those patients who have Cirrhosis (a long-term liver disease) are more likely to have a low level of vitamin D, and the level decreases significantly in patients with alcoholic liver cirrhosis rather than primary biliary Cirrhosis. In liver cirrhosis, the damage caused by hepatitis, other viruses, and alcohol cannot be reversed.
